2021-7-20 · I n this tutorial we are going to see how to create a primary key in MySQL. In MySQL a primary key is a single field or a combination of fields that uniquely defines a record. None of the fields in the primary key can contain NULL value. In MySQL a table can have only one primary key.
2 days ago · MySQL PRIMARY KEY Constraint The PRIMARY KEY constraint uniquely identifies each record in a table. Primary keys must contain UNIQUE values and cannot contain NULL values. A table can have only ONE primary key and in the table this primary key can consist of
1.7.3.1 PRIMARY KEY and UNIQUE Index Constraints. Normally errors occur for data-change statements (such as INSERT or UPDATE) that would violate primary-key unique-key or foreign-key constraints. If you are using a transactional storage engine such as InnoDB MySQL automatically rolls back the statement.
2021-7-20 · I n this tutorial we are going to see how to create a primary key in MySQL. In MySQL a primary key is a single field or a combination of fields that uniquely defines a record. None of the fields in the primary key can contain NULL value. In MySQL a table can have only one primary key.
2 days ago · Introduction to MySQL primary key. A primary key is a column or a set of columns that uniquely identifies each row in the table. The primary key follows these rules A primary key must contain unique values. If the primary key consists of multiple columns the combination of values in these columns must be unique.
2012-4-4 · How important a primary key design can be for MySQL performance The answer is Extremely If tables use InnoDB storage engine that is. It all begins with the specific way InnoDB organizes data internally. There are two major pieces of information that anyone should know It physically stores rows together with and in the order of primary key
2016-5-21 · Primary Key and Foreign Key in MySQL Explained with Examples Submitted by Sarath Pillai on Sat 05/21/201620 39 MySQL is the most widely used open source relational database management system in the world.
2017-2-20 · mysql mysql alter table table_name drop primary key table_test 1 table_test create table table_test( `id` varchar(100) NOT NULL `nam
2015-7-25 · MySQL two-columns Primary Key with auto-increment. Everyone working with MySQL (and DBMS in general) knows about the AUTO_INCREMENT attribute that can be used on a columnoften the primary keyto generate a unique identity for new rows. To make a quick example let s take the most classic example from the MySQL online manual
2020-5-12 · Primary Key SQL Foreign Unique key MySQL with Table Example. Every developer wants to know about Primary Key SQL. By the way In MySQL table already existing primary key fields. Thus in these fields constraints MySQL primary key is unique for each row and also discusses foreign key SQL. Over there an option for autoincrement primary key.
A primary key is a NOT NULL single or a multi-column identifier which uniquely identifies a row of a table. An index is created and if not explicitly declared as NOT NULL MySQL will declare them so silently and implicitly. A table can have only one PRIMARY KEY and each table is recommended to have one. InnoDB will automatically create one in
2018-11-30 · MySQL MySQLi Database. To remove primary key in MySQL use tje drop primary key command. To understand the concept let us create a table with column as primary key. mysql> create table PrimaryKeyDemo -> ( -> id int not null -> Primary key(id) -> ) Query OK 0 rows affected (0.60 sec) Let us check the description of the table with the help of
2012-4-4 · How important a primary key design can be for MySQL performance The answer is Extremely If tables use InnoDB storage engine that is. It all begins with the specific way InnoDB organizes data internally. There are two major pieces of information that anyone should know It physically stores rows together with and in the order of primary key
2017-5-31 · PRIMARY KEYKEY NOT NULL NOT NULL MySQL PRIMARY KEY MySQL Index Key
2021-7-20 · Summary this tutorial introduces you to MySQL UUID shows you to use it as the primary key (PK) for a table and discusses the pros and cons of using it as the primary key.. Introduction to MySQL UUID. UUID stands for Universally Unique IDentifier. UUID is defined based on RFC 4122 "a Universally Unique Identifier (UUID) URN Namespace).. UUID is designed as a number that is unique
2021-7-21 · Introduction to MySQL Primary Key. The following article provides an outline for MySQL Primary Key. When we create the tables to store the data in the database at that time in order to recognize the row and identify each of the records stored in the table we use indexes.
2020-7-14 · MySQL Composite Primary Key Index. You can create an index for composite primary key that uses the same fields present in your composite primary key. mysql> alter table new_orders ADD INDEX new_index (order_id product_id) Hopefully now you can create composite primary key in MySQL. Ubiq makes it easy to visualize data in minutes and monitor
2021-3-19 · What you have here is a primary key that is a composite of three fields. Thus you cannot "drop the primary key on a column". You can drop the primary key or not drop the primary key. If you want a primary key that only includes one column you can drop the existing primary key on 3 columns and create a new primary key on 1 column.
2020-5-20 · If we have to alter or modify the primary key of a table in an existing mysql table the following steps will help you. For a table without primary key For single primary key ALTER TABLE table_name ADD PRIMARY KEY(your_primary_key) For composite primary key ALTER TABLE table_name ADD PRIMARY KEY(key1 key2 key3) For a
1.7.3.1 PRIMARY KEY and UNIQUE Index Constraints. Normally errors occur for data-change statements (such as INSERT or UPDATE) that would violate primary-key unique-key or foreign-key constraints. If you are using a transactional storage engine such as InnoDB MySQL automatically rolls back the statement.
2021-7-19 · The primary key can be any field or column of a table which should be a unique and non-null value for each record or a row. The Foreign key is a field that contains the primary key of some other table to establish a connection between each other. Let s have a look at the syntax and different examples to create primary and foreign keys in MySQL.
2020-6-5 · Primary keys increase search accuracy and performance and they enhance cross-reference relationships between tables. A table can have only one primary key and a primary key field cannot contain a null value. We require the definition of a primary key on each table in every new MySQL database created after 26 May 2020.
2013-8-29 · mysqlUNIQUE KEYPRIMARY KEY 1 Primary key1NOT NULL NULL PRIMARY KEY NOT NULL UNIQUE KEY 2 PRIMARY KEY
2019-3-11 · primary key not null unique innodb innodb id
2020-8-10 · In this way no primary key will be automatically generated but the creation of tables without a primary key will fail. MySQL 8.0 introduced a better variable sql_require_primary_key. It simply disallows to create tables without a primary key or drop a primary key from an
A primary key (also referred to as a unique key) is a column that has been allocated as the unique identifier field. The value in a primary key column is unique to each record. In other words no two records can share the same value on that column. A classic example of a primary key
2019-9-7 · PRIMARY KEY 1 2 n 3 emp3 id name deptId
2011-2-27 · 242. After adding the column you can always add the primary key ALTER TABLE goods ADD PRIMARY KEY (id) As to why your script wasn t working you need to specify PRIMARY KEY not just the word PRIMARY alter table goods add column `id` int (10) unsigned primary KEY AUTO_INCREMENT Share. Improve this answer. answered Feb 27 11 at 11 29.
Normally errors occur for data-change statements (such as INSERT or UPDATE) that would violate primary-key unique-key or foreign-key constraints. If you are using a transactional storage engine such as InnoDB MySQL automatically rolls back the statement. If you are using a nontransactional storage engine MySQL stops processing the statement at the row for which the error occurred and leaves any
2021-7-20 · AUTO_INCREMENT for PRIMARY KEY We can add a new column like an id that auto increments itself for every row that is inserted to the table. In this MySQL Tutorial we shall create a new column that is PRIMARY KEY with AUTO_INCREMENT column modifier. To add a new column to MySQL following is the syntax of the SQL Query Example 1AUTO_INCREMENT for PRIMARY KEY
2021-6-5 · MySQL Only one auto_increment key is generated to uniquely identify a row in a table. There is not a lot of explanation behind why but just implementation. Depending on datatype auto_increment values are fixed by the length of datatype in bytes Max TINYINT is
2021-7-19 · The primary key can be any field or column of a table which should be a unique and non-null value for each record or a row. The Foreign key is a field that contains the primary key of some other table to establish a connection between each other. Let s have a look at the syntax and different examples to create primary and foreign keys in MySQL.
2020-11-25 · primary key() auto_increment poreign key() not null() unique key() default() primary key 1
2011-2-27 · 242. After adding the column you can always add the primary key ALTER TABLE goods ADD PRIMARY KEY (id) As to why your script wasn t working you need to specify PRIMARY KEY not just the word PRIMARY alter table goods add column `id` int (10) unsigned primary KEY AUTO_INCREMENT Share. Improve this answer. answered Feb 27 11 at 11 29.
2020-11-25 · primary key() auto_increment poreign key() not null() unique key() default() primary key 1
2017-2-20 · mysql mysql alter table table_name drop primary key table_test 1 table_test create table table_test( `id` varchar(100) NOT NULL `nam
2020-5-20 · If we have to alter or modify the primary key of a table in an existing mysql table the following steps will help you. For a table without primary key For single primary key ALTER TABLE table_name ADD PRIMARY KEY(your_primary_key) For composite primary key ALTER TABLE table_name ADD PRIMARY KEY(key1 key2 key3) For a
2015-7-25 · MySQL two-columns Primary Key with auto-increment. Everyone working with MySQL (and DBMS in general) knows about the AUTO_INCREMENT attribute that can be used on a columnoften the primary keyto generate a unique identity for new rows. To make a quick example let s take the most classic example from the MySQL online manual
2017-2-20 · mysql mysql alter table table_name drop primary key table_test 1 table_test create table table_test( `id` varchar(100) NOT NULL `nam
A primary key (also referred to as a unique key) is a column that has been allocated as the unique identifier field. The value in a primary key column is unique to each record. In other words no two records can share the same value on that column. A classic example of a primary key